Assam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ma joined hundreds at Salbari in Baksa district, Assam on June 21 to mark the 11th International Yoga Day.
The large-scale celebration witnessed enthusiastic participation from over 2,000 people representing diverse walks of life.
Accompanying the Chief Minister at the event were Bodoland Territorial Region (BTR) Chief Executive Member Pramod Boro, Ministers Jayanta Malla Baruah and Urkhao Gwra Brahma, and local MLA Phanidhar Talukdar. Several executive members and councilors of the BTR were also present, underscoring the region’s unified commitment to promoting health and mindfulness.
The program featured collective yoga sessions aimed at encouraging holistic well-being and spreading awareness of yoga’s benefits in daily life.
Following the session, Chief Minister Sarma addressed the media, highlighting the growing importance of yoga in fostering physical and mental health, particularly among the youth. He also made several key observations on regional development and the state’s governance priorities.
